Provenance Dog Park sits at the corner of Sherwood Rd and Wakeman Rd in Huntly, VIC 3551, inside the Provenance Estate housing community. It is a resident-exclusive amenity, not a public park. Access is limited to residents and their visitors, so non-residents should not plan a trip here expecting to use it.

The rules. Owners must supervise their dogs at all times and pick up after them. The park is fenced and secure, which means off-leash play is fine within the boundary. The key restriction is access: if you are not a Provenance Estate resident or an invited guest, you cannot enter.

What's there. Open green space for running and exercise, plus some seating where owners can sit while dogs play. The park is confirmed as a currently operating community amenity via the Provenance Bendigo community Facebook page, which includes a dedicated post about the dog park for residents.

When to go. Weekday late afternoons (roughly 4 to 6pm) and weekend mornings (9 to 11am) are the busiest periods, when resident groups tend to gather. Mid-morning on weekdays is reported as quieter. Public transport to the area is limited, so driving via the Midland Highway onto Sherwood Road is the practical option.
